(
b ) by omitting from sub-regulation (2.) the words “Three pounds seventeen shillings” and inserting in their stead the words “Four pounds ten shillings”; and(
c ) by omitting sub-regulation (3.) and inserting in its stead the following sub-regulation:—“(3.) After an officer or employee has resided in the one locality for a period of twenty-one days, the officer or employee shall be paid an allowance equal to the amount expended by the officer or employee on accommodation, sustenance and incidental expenses or, if the Board is satisfied that the amount so expended is not reasonable having regard to the status of the officer or employee and the purposes for which the officer or employee is performing duty whilst absent from his headquarters, such amount as the Board considers reasonable in the circumstances.”.
